There are three types of female masks used in Noh: young, middle aged, and old, each of which includes examples of "normal" and "heightened" states of being. "Zo onna" was named by its creator Zo ami. Unlike Ko omote or Waka onna, the mask does not display joy or cuteness. Instead, it reflects calmness, purity, and peaceful images of deities of ancient Japan.
